Let’s start with what’s under the hood. The 2025 Subaru Forester is all about adventure. It's built with Subaru’s standard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ive and powered by a 2.5-liter engine delivering 180 horsepower. This SUV is ideal if you love exploring rough roads, snowy paths, or mountain trails. It's not the fastest in a straight line, but it’s strong, reliable, and great for unpredictable driving conditions. Transfer Ownership Without Delay The first and most crucial step is transferring the car’s ownership into your name. In India, this must be done at your local Regional Transport Office (RTO).
